WordPressはその柔軟性と拡張性から多くのユーザーに支持されています。その一つの特徴が「カスタムフィールド」です。カスタムフィールドを使えば、投稿やページに対して標準のフィールド以外の情報を追加できるため、サイトをよりリッチでユーザーインタラクティブにすることができます。しかし、カスタムフィールドの操作には少し技術的な知識が必要です。そこで、今回はカスタムフィールドを簡単かつ効果的に活用するためのプラグインを7つご紹介します。
1. Advanced Custom Fields (ACF)
Advanced Custom Fieldsは、最も人気のあるカスタムフィールドのプラグインの一つです。簡単なUIでフィールドの追加や管理ができ、初心者でも扱いやすいのが特徴です。プロバージョンではリピートフィールドやフレキシブルコンテンツレイアウトなどの高度な機能が利用でき、複雑なレイアウトを手軽に作成できます。
主な機能:
- 簡単なUIでフィールド追加
- 複数のフィールドタイプ対応
- 高度なレイアウト機能(プロ版)
2. Meta Box
Meta Boxは、カスタムフィールドを高度にカスタマイズしたいユーザー向けの強力なツールです。複雑なフィールドグループを作成でき、さまざまなデータタイプや条件ロジックにも対応しています。また、APIを利用することで、開発者はさらに高度なカスタマイズを行うことができます。
主な機能:
- 高度にカスタマイズ可能
- 条件付きフィールド表示
- REST API対応
3. Toolset Types
カスタムフィールドだけでなく、カスタムポストタイプや分類も管理できるオールインワンのプラグインです。Toolset Typesを利用することで、WordPressサイトをコーディングなしで自在にカスタマイズできます。また、WooCommerceサイトの拡張にも対応しているため、ECサイトにも適合します。
主な機能:
- カスタムポストタイプと分類の管理
- WooCommerce向け機能
- コーディングなしでのカスタマイズ
4. Pods – Custom Content Types and Fields
Podsは、カスタムコンテンツタイプやカスタムフィールドを操作するための強力なフレームワークを提供します。このプラグインを使用すれば、フィールドのバリデーションや複数のコンテンツとの関係性の設定など、より複雑な操作も可能になります。開発者にとっては無償で使用できる点も魅力です。
主な機能:
- カスタムコンテンツ管理フレームワーク
- 高度なフィールドバリデーション
- 無償で利用可能
5. Carbon Fields
Carbon Fieldsは、開発者にフォーカスしたプラグインです。フィールドの定義をコードで行うことができ、柔軟かつ高度なデータの管理が可能です。開発者向けのドキュメントが充実しており、プログラミングが得意な方には非常に便利です。
主な機能:
- コードベースでのフィールド管理
- 開発者向けの詳細なドキュメンテーション
- フレキシブルな複数フィールドタイプ
6. JetEngine
JetEngineは、Elementorユーザーに最適なプラグインです。Elementorと高度に統合されており、ビジュアルエディターでのデザインが可能です。カスタムフィールドだけでなく、カスタムポストタイプやリストンググリッドの作成も多機能でサポートしています。
主な機能:
- Elementorとの統合
- ビジュアルエディターでの操作
- 多機能なグリッドとレイアウトオプション
7. Custom Post Type UI
このプラグインは、カスタムポストタイプとカスタム分類の作成と管理に特化しています。シンプルなUIで直感的に操作できるため、初心者にもおすすめです。カスタムフィールドを追加する際の基盤として非常に便利です。
主な機能:
- シンプルなインターフェース
- 初心者に優しい
- カスタムポストタイプと分類の管理
まとめ
カスタムフィールドを使ってWordPressサイトのポテンシャルを最大限に引き出すことは、ユーザー体験を向上させるうえで非常に重要です。しかし、カスタムフィールドの導入と管理は、慣れないと少々手間がかかる場合もあります。ここで紹介したプラグインは、そのプロセスを大幅に簡素化し、効率的に管理する手助けをしてくれるでしょう。それぞれのプラグインには特有の特徴があるため、サイトの要件や個々のスキルレベルに応じて選んでみてください。これらのツールを駆使して、WordPressサイトを一歩先のステージへ成長させましょう。

